Strain development | Developed by Michael McBurney, Ottawa Regional Cancer Centre and Department of Medicine, University of Ottawa. A hygromycin resistance cassette was inserted to replace exons 5 and 6. 129 background. |
Strain description | SirT1 knockout mice. A hygromycin resistance cassette was inserted to replace exons 5 and 6 of Sirt1 gene. Homozygous mutant mice die at birth. When outbred to CD1, SirT1 KO mice have short snouts, eyelid defect and are smaller than littermates at weaning. |
